Youll be ok if All the amps Blow the cooling air the same way!
( most suck the air from the back of the amp over the output
devices and then blow it out the front )
I did have a problem once with 2 Big MATRIX amplifiers in a community
building that only shut down when they were being thrashed.
after a couple of visits i came back one night at 10 oclock during a gig!.
BINGO some pudding had assembed the amp with the fan mounted the wrong way so one amp pushed hot air out the front... which the other sucked IN the front and pushed out the back....which the first amp then sucked the very hot air in the back heated it more and pushed it out the front etc etc the 2 amps then got so hot they took it in turns to shut down!!
problem solved by reversing the fan in the defective amp!!!
